A fabulous pair of George III shield-back or ‘escutcheon’ pattern chairs, attributed to Gillows. C.1780
With refined and elegant proportions, caned seats intact above tapering forelegs. Fine hand painted details expressing flower bells and tulips.
This design of a five-splat shield back chair with a ‘camel back stay rail’ is referenced in Susan E. Stuarts, Gillows of Lancaster and London, Volume 1, page 165.
